Output 7405127f05d53dbdb3de690e5d37b51157fd083e736c11ac14234ab3a1aa5990:35

value
152948361
script pubkey
OP_0 OP_PUSHBYTES_20 83bb75a1a52fa45f24e994b92d1b2bea83133be9
address
bc1qswahtgd997j97f8fjjuj6xeta2p3xwlfzdcs05
transaction
7405127f05d53dbdb3de690e5d37b51157fd083e736c11ac14234ab3a1aa5990
spent
true